RFC 4166: Telephony Signalling Transport over Stream Control Transmission Protocol (SCTP) Applicability Statement

In plain English — editorial summary, not part of the RFC

This document describes the applicability of the several protocols developed under the signalling transport framework. A description of the main issues regarding the use of the Stream Control Transmission Protocol (SCTP) and an explanation of each adaptation layer for transport of telephony signalling information over IP infrastructure are given. This memo provides information for the Internet community.
